Is it alone?

If you find a newborn kitten you first need to find out if it’s alone. Most likely there will be more kittens close by. Look in the bushes or other areas around where you found the kitten. Mother cats will move their kittens to keep them safe. This is done one at a time. If you’ve found one, then she probably hasn’t had a chance to move the rest yet.

If at all possible, try to find the mother cat. If this is a house cat, then you can alert the cat’s owner who might not even know that their cat had kittens. If you are dealing with a feral cat, you should always try to trap it. Baby kittens stand the best chance of survival if they have their mother’s milk. If this is a feral situation, you will definitely want to talk with an experienced rescue group before attempting to handle this on your own. Live animal traps can be found at most feed shops.

When a Mothers care is not an option

Sometimes kittens are abandoned by their mother. This might be because the mom was young and inexperienced, she got scared away from her litter or because she decided that something was wrong with them. Unfortunately, sometimes these kittens are too sick to save, although most cat and kitten rescues will do all they can to save them.

If you find one or more abandoned kittens then you need to move fast. Newborn kittens dehydrate very quickly. Depending on their age, they must be fed a high quality kitten formula every one to three hours, both day and night. They must be burped, handled carefully and helped with elimination every time they are fed. They must be kept warm and safe, but not so much that they overheat.

If you or someone you know finds a kitten, please contact an experienced professional immediately for advice. Most veterinarians can offer suggestions on their care. Bottle-fed kittens

Stray and abandoned newborn kittens are found all the time. These babies are helpless without human intervention. If a surrogate mother isn’t available, they must be bottle-fed around the clock. This includes waking up throughout the night, assisting them with elimination and keeping them warm and safe from harm. It’s a lot like taking care of a newborn child. Kitten formula even costs about the same as human formula.

Bottle-fed kittens are very comfortable around humans and can be extremely affectionate. When socialized from a young age, they can be taught to live with other pets and children. Bottle-fed kittens make wonderful pets.

Adult cats

Adult cats are frequently abandoned. The usual reasons include behavior problems, moving and allergies. However, with the right care and attention, all if these issues can be avoided or corrected. When adult cats are abandoned, they often become depressed and fearful of people and other pets. A rescue facility can work with these pets to correct any behavior issues and help them trust humans again. Once adopted, adult cats are often extremely affectionate and grateful to be loved.

Cats with special needs

Sometimes elderly and disabled cats are abandoned. This is an especially difficult situation. Elderly and disabled cats require a lot of love and attention. While rescue facilities can help these cats feel confident around humans, living in a permanent home is the most ideal situation for these feline friends. Elderly and disabled cats can make wonderful companions for those willing to give them a chance.

Not many places in Orange County offer cat grooming. Occasionally a grooming shop will accept cats, but they attempt to treat them as if they were dogs. The problem with this approach is that cats require a much different grooming experience. For example, cats cannot be tethered, most dog shampoos are not safe for them, they are slow to trust and they become easily stressed. A cat that is stressed is more likely to hurt itself and those around it. Cats can also suffer from a variety of stress-related health issues.
